Output 3c8ab93630886d16d59bbcdfff88bf7eb5095500ae0e6a484a8a4fbdecd7a452:19

value
123613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433d9245458c3d29771b97e7718ef81b9ef5e2ec OP_EQUAL
address
37pYxT4YCVMP2QJRrK99VGohmgGebMft14
transaction
3c8ab93630886d16d59bbcdfff88bf7eb5095500ae0e6a484a8a4fbdecd7a452
confirmations
269987
spent
true